In this weeks discussion we were given the task of selecting a Wi-Fi that would best suit the needs and design of a sports stadium. After reviewing all this weeks’ material and assigned reading, I believe the best choice for Wi-Fi in a sports stadium would be the high-density Wi-Fi from Cisco.

I chose to use Cisco’s Wi-Fi based off of the challenges that lay in a stadium.   Stadiums have many seats, large areas and thousands of pounds of steal in which a single could possible get lots. The Cisco Wi-Fi network was designed to face and overcome such obstacles. I also selected the Cisco network due to the amount of traffic the network will have to handle at any give time. When fans pack the seats they are excited and egger to share were they are, whom they are with and what’s happing at the stadium. This will cause a peak in the usage of the network, other connections may lag of even completely fail.
